In recent years, the intimate apparel market in China has undergone a quiet revolution. No longer just about function, modern Chinese lingerie is a canvas of self-expression, blending tradition with cutting-edge design. From minimalist silhouettes to bold cultural motifs, the aesthetic evolution tells a story of empowerment, identity, and digital influence.

What’s driving this shift? It’s not just fashion—it’s feminism, social media, and a new generation unafraid to redefine beauty. According to Statista, China’s lingerie market reached $22.5 billion in 2023, with a projected CAGR of 7.3% through 2028. But beyond the numbers, there’s a deeper narrative: Chinese women are embracing lingerie that feels as good as it looks—comfort meets couture.
Brands like NEIWAI (内外) and Ubras have led the charge, championing body positivity and gender-neutral aesthetics. NEIWAI’s slogan, “True to Me,” isn’t just marketing—it’s a movement. Their best-selling cloud-knit bra, made from ultra-soft bamboo fiber, sold over 1.2 million units in 2023. Why? Because it’s seamless, wire-free, and designed for real bodies—not runway fantasies.
Meanwhile, heritage elements are making a comeback. Designers are weaving in ink-wash patterns, silk embroidery, and mandarin-inspired cuts to create pieces that honor tradition while feeling utterly modern. Take the ‘Moonlit Lotus’ collection by Shanghai-based label Lingerie X: each piece features hand-stitched peonies and jade closures, retailing at $120–$180—a testament to the growing appetite for luxury with meaning.
Key Aesthetic Trends Shaping 2024
- Minimalism with a Twist: Clean lines, neutral palettes (think sand, mist, and blush), but with subtle asymmetry or hidden details.
- Cultural Fusion: East-meets-West designs—qipao necklines meet French lace; silk slips with geometric cutouts.
- Sustainable Sensuality: Organic cotton, recycled lace, and biodegradable packaging are now expected, not exceptional.
- Genderless Lingerie: Unisex cuts and campaigns featuring non-binary models are redefining intimacy.
Market Breakdown: Top Brands & Consumer Preferences
| Brand | Core Aesthetic | Price Range (USD) | 2023 Sales Growth |
|---|---|---|---|
| NEIWAI | Minimalist, gender-neutral | 30–90 | +42% |
| Ubras | Comfort-tech, seamless | 25–70 | +58% |
| Lingerie X | Luxury, cultural fusion | 100–200 | +35% |
| Aimer | Classic European style | 40–120 | +18% |
So, what does this mean for global fashion? China isn’t just following trends—it’s setting them. The rise of livestream shopping on platforms like Douyin and Xiaohongshu means a single viral try-on video can sell out a collection in hours. And consumers aren’t just buying bras—they’re buying values: sustainability, inclusivity, authenticity.
